Not producing a force that pushes backward when fired, usually describing weapons like guns or rifles. It means there is little or no recoil when it is used.

الاستخدام والفروق الدقيقة

'Recoilless' is almost always used in technical or military contexts, usually before nouns as in 'recoilless rifle.' It describes a weapon engineered to reduce or eliminate backward movement after firing. Not used in everyday conversation. Do not confuse with 'recoil,' which is the backward force itself.
